Who We Are:

IPS Custom Automation is a leading provider of advanced
manufacturing solutions for the defense and energetics industries. We
specialize in the design, engineering, and integration of turnkey production
lines for energetics materials and munitions. Our solutions serve government
agencies, military contractors, and defense OEMs worldwide.

What You’ll Do: You’ll also be responsible for:

  • Lead
    Program Operations from contract award through closeout, ensuring
    performance across cost, schedule, technical and quality objectives.
  • Oversee
    the planning across subsystems and functions that feed financial systems
    and the Integrated Master Schedules (IMS).
  • Manage subcontractor
    performance, ensuring delivery of required data and attainment of
    technical milestones.
  • Oversee
    program Estimate At Completion (EAC) development and accuracy in
    coordination with team leads and provide monthly forecasting outputs for
    executive review.
  • Drive
    accountability for program performance metrics through formal reviews,
    risk analysis, and mitigation planning.
  • Lead new
    business captures and proposals within the defense portfolio.
  • Partner
    with leadership on budgeting, resource planning, and contract
    profitability tracking.
  • Lead and
    support Program Management Reviews and other contractual engagements.
  • Support
    digital integration of program and operations data for improved insight,
    responsiveness, and audit readiness.
  • Mentor and
    develop program managers, project leads, and functional contributors with
    a focus on execution rigor and compliance-first culture.
  • Performs
    other job duties as assigned and deemed appropriate by management.
